org.ow2.dragon.ui.businessdelegate.spring.organization
Class PostManagerImpl

java.lang.Object
  extended by org.ow2.dragon.ui.businessdelegate.spring.organization.PostManagerImpl
All Implemented Interfaces:
org.ow2.dragon.api.service.organization.PostManager

public class PostManagerImpl
extends java.lang.Object
implements org.ow2.dragon.api.service.organization.PostManager

Author:
ofabre - eBM WebSourcing

Constructor Summary
PostManagerImpl(org.springframework.context.ApplicationContext context)
           
 
Method Summary
 java.lang.String createPost(org.ow2.dragon.api.to.organization.PostTO arg0)
           
 java.util.List<org.ow2.dragon.api.to.organization.PostTO> getAllPosts(org.ow2.dragon.api.to.RequestOptionsTO arg0)
           
 org.ow2.dragon.api.to.organization.PostTO getPost(java.lang.String arg0)
           
 java.util.List<org.ow2.dragon.api.to.organization.PostTO> getPostsNotLinkedToOrganization(java.lang.String arg0, org.ow2.dragon.api.to.RequestOptionsTO arg1)
           
 java.util.List<org.ow2.dragon.api.to.organization.PostTO> getPostsNotLinkedToPersons(org.ow2.dragon.api.to.RequestOptionsTO requestOptionsTO)
           
 void removePost(java.lang.String arg0)
           
 java.util.List<org.ow2.dragon.api.to.organization.PostTO> searchPost(java.lang.String searchCriteria, java.util.List<org.ow2.dragon.api.to.organization.PostSearchProperties> searchedProperties, org.ow2.dragon.api.to.RequestOptionsTO requestOptionsTO)
           
 java.lang.String updatePost(org.ow2.dragon.api.to.organization.PostTO arg0)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PostManagerImpl

public PostManagerImpl(org.springframework.context.ApplicationContext context)
Method Detail

createPost

public java.lang.String createPost(org.ow2.dragon.api.to.organization.PostTO arg0)
                            thro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
createPost in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

getAllPosts

public java.util.List<org.ow2.dragon.api.to.organization.PostTO> getAllPosts(org.ow2.dragon.api.to.RequestOptionsTO arg0)
Specified by:
getAllPosts in interface org.ow2.dragon.api.service.organization.PostManager

getPostsNotLinkedToOrganization

public java.util.List<org.ow2.dragon.api.to.organization.PostTO> getPostsNotLinkedToOrganization(java.lang.String arg0,
                                                                                                 org.ow2.dragon.api.to.RequestOptionsTO arg1)
                                                                                          thro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
getPostsNotLinkedToOrganization in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

getPost

public org.ow2.dragon.api.to.organization.PostTO getPost(java.lang.String arg0)
                                                  thro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
getPost in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

removePost

public void removePost(java.lang.String arg0)
                thro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
removePost in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

updatePost

public java.lang.String updatePost(org.ow2.dragon.api.to.organization.PostTO arg0)
                            thro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
updatePost in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

searchPost

public java.util.List<org.ow2.dragon.api.to.organization.PostTO> searchPost(java.lang.String searchCriteria,
                                                                            java.util.List<org.ow2.dragon.api.to.organization.PostSearchProperties> searchedProperties,
                                                                            org.ow2.dragon.api.to.RequestOptionsTO requestOptionsTO)
                                                                     thro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
searchPost in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Exception

getPostsNotLinkedToPersons

public java.util.List<org.ow2.dragon.api.to.organization.PostTO> getPostsNotLinkedToPersons(org.ow2.dragon.api.to.RequestOptionsTO requestOptionsTO)
                                                                                     throws org.ow2.dragon.api.service.organization.OrganizationException
Specified by:
getPostsNotLinkedToPersons in interface org.ow2.dragon.api.service.organization.PostManager
Throws:
org.ow2.dragon.api.service.organization.OrganizationException


Copyright © 2008-2010 eBMWebsourcing. All Rights Reserved.